Sur les plateformes de commerce électronique modernes, les avis sur les produits sont l'une des références très importantes que les consommateurs peuvent utiliser lors du choix des produits. Afin d'améliorer encore l'expérience utilisateur, de nombreux centres commerciaux ajouteront une fonction J'aime permettant aux utilisateurs d'aimer les commentaires sur leurs produits préférés. Cet article explique comment utiliser la fonction d'évaluation des produits et de like dans PHP Developer City.
1. Créez des tables de base de données
Tout d'abord, créez deux tables dans la base de données MySQL, à savoir "comments" et "likes". La table « commentaires » est utilisée pour stocker les informations sur les avis sur les produits, et la table « j'aime » est utilisée pour enregistrer les informations « J'aime » de l'utilisateur sur les commentaires. La table « commentaires » peut inclure les champs suivants : ID de commentaire (comment_id), contenu du commentaire (content), ID utilisateur (user_id) et ID produit (product_id). La table "J'aime" peut inclure les champs suivants : like ID (like_id), user ID (user_id) et comment ID (comment_id).
2. Affichage frontal
Dans la page de détails du produit, affichez la liste des avis du produit et affichez un bouton J'aime pour chaque avis. Vous pouvez utiliser HTML et CSS pour créer le style de la liste de révision et utiliser le code PHP pour obtenir des informations de révision à partir de la base de données et générer dynamiquement la liste de révision.
3. Implémentation de la fonction J'aime
4. Mise à jour du front-end
Sur la page front-end, mettez à jour le statut du bouton J'aime en fonction des résultats renvoyés par le back-end, par exemple, changez-le pour le style que vous aimez et affichez la mise à jour du nombre de likes après.
5. Considérations de sécurité
Afin d'assurer la sécurité du système, certaines considérations de sécurité doivent être prises en compte :
Grâce aux étapes ci-dessus, nous pouvons implémenter la fonction similaire des avis sur les produits dans le centre commercial développé par PHP. Cette fonctionnalité peut non seulement améliorer l'engagement et la satisfaction des utilisateurs, mais également fournir des informations de référence précieuses à d'autres consommateurs et promouvoir la communication et le comportement d'achat. Dans le même temps, nous devons également veiller à assurer la sécurité du système et à assurer le fonctionnement normal des fonctions similaires.
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!